Mappe und Tafeln gering angeknickt. - The illustrations to the poems of Alisher Navoi are the finest examples of the miniature-painting of the Timurid period, which reached the highest stage of development in Khorasan and Central Asia in the 15th and in the first half of the 16th centuries. Created as illustrations to Alisher Navoi's poems The Wonder of the Pious,Farhad and Shirin, Layli and Majnun, Seven Planets, The Wall of Iskandar and The Language of the Birds,the miniatures belong to the brush of the great Eastern painter Kamal ad-Din Behzad, founder of the Herat school of miniature-painting, and his pupils Kasim Ali, Dust Muhammad, Mirak Naqqash and Mahmud Mudhahhib. The heroes of Navoi's poems served as the main images for these miniatures - the brilliant works of the world art. They are notable for their social ideals, noble qualities, and optimistic spirit. The inimitable beauty of the miniatures derives from the delicate brushwork, the bright but subtle colours, multiplane composition and harmonious balance of details. Realism which underlies all Alisher Navoi's work is characteristic of these miniatures. The miniatures are a brilliant embodiment of the aesthetic ideals and artistic genius of the Uzbek people.
